Having talked to Scott Ian on three separate occasions for three different publications, I'm still not sure if he's a jerk, hardened New Yorker who carries the city's attitude with him wherever he goes or is just always on constant alert (i.e. paranoia) that people (i.e. interviewers, media, etc.) are trying to "gotcha!" him for... Continue Reading →

